Elucidating the exact pharmacological mechanism of motion (MOA) of The natural way happening compounds may be tough. Although Tarselli et al. (sixty) produced the primary de novo synthetic pathway to conolidine and showcased this Normally occurring compound successfully suppresses responses to both chemically induced and inflammation-derived discomfort, the pharmacologic target accountable for its antinociceptive motion remained elusive. Given the complications affiliated with standard pharmacological and physiological ways, Mendis et al. utilized cultured neuronal networks grown on multi-electrode array (MEA) technologies coupled with pattern matching response profiles to provide a possible MOA of conolidine (sixty one). A comparison of drug consequences while in the MEA cultures of central anxious program Energetic compounds identified that the response profile of conolidine was most similar to that of ω-conotoxin CVIE, a Cav2.

Plants are actually historically a supply of analgesic alkaloids, Despite the fact that their pharmacological characterization is often restricted. Among these kinds of natural analgesic molecules, conolidine, located in the bark on the tropical flowering shrub Tabernaemontana divaricata, also known as pinwheel flower or crepe jasmine, has very long been Utilized in classic Chinese, Ayurvedic and Thai medicines to take care of fever and pain4 (Fig. 1a). Pharmacologists have only just lately been in a position to confirm its medicinal and pharmacological Qualities thanks to its very first asymmetric complete synthesis.5 Conolidine is actually a rare C5-nor stemmadenine (Fig. 1b), which shows potent analgesia in in vivo products of tonic and persistent discomfort and lowers inflammatory pain reduction. It had been also recommended that conolidine-induced analgesia may possibly absence troubles usually connected to classical opioid medicines.
